Cognitive Coaching(SM) for Educational Leaders.

Cognitive Coaching(SM) was developed as a means to support teachers with their teaching. It is based upon the premise that teaching is a professional act and Coaches within schools support teachers to become more resourceful in their teaching. Many schools have employed coaches to work with their community and some education systems are employing coaches to support teachers to improve teaching and learning across their contexts.

Cognitive Coaching – A series of professional learning days

In Victoria, towards the end of July, ANSN and the Center for Cognitive Coaching℠. will be presenting "Learning to Coach, Coaching to Learn – A series of Professional Learning Days". Each of the days in the series has been designed either to introduce or extend participants’ knowledge on the principles of Cognitive Coaching℠, which was developed in the US by Art Costa and Robert Garmston.
